Apache Hive
Tipo di connessione | ODBC (64 bit) |
Requisiti di configurazione del driver | Per prestazioni ottimali, devi abilitare l'opzione "FastSQLPrepare" (Preparazione SQL rapida) nelle opzioni avanzate del driver per consentire ad Alteryx di recuperare i metadati senza eseguire una query. |
Tipo di supporto | Lettura e scrittura, In-Database |
Convalidato su | Database versione 2.3.1.3.0.1.0-187 Client ODBC versione 2.06.10.1010 |
Per ulteriori informazioni sul driver ODBC Simba, consulta la documentazione sugli ODBC Simba .
Errore di riferimento colonna non valido
Simba ha introdotto una funzione nel driver che garantisce che tutti i nomi delle colonne siano univoci durante la lettura dei dati. Questa funzione fa sì che Alteryx non riconosca i nomi delle colonne. Si tratta di una funzione nascosta che è possibile disattivare se non puoi modificare la query per evitare l'errore. Puoi impostare hive.resultset.use.unique.column.names su false come Proprietà lato server in Configurazione DSN driver ODBC o Configurazione driver ODBC. In alternativa, puoi aggiungere un parametro della stringa di connessione: EnableUniqueColumnName=0. Per ulteriori informazioni e istruzioni su questa operazione, consulta l' articolo della community sull'errore di riferimento colonna non valido .
Strumenti Alteryx utilizzati per Connect
Elaborazione del flusso di lavoro standard
Elaborazione del flusso di lavoro In-Database
Ulteriori dettagli
L'opzione Use Native Query (Usa query nativa) nel driver ODBC Simba per Hive non è supportata per Scrivi InDB o Flusso di dati in entrata InDB .
Hive non gestisce correttamente la scrittura di caratteri multibyte in stringhe ampie (WStrings). Per ulteriori informazioni, consulta l'articolo sul problema di SQL INSERT per i caratteri Unicode® .
In caso di problemi di lettura o scrittura dei caratteri Unicode®, accedi al driver ODBC Simba per Impala. In Advanced Options (Opzioni avanzate), seleziona l'opzione Use SQL Unicode Types (Usa tipi SQL Unicode).
L'opzione Crea nuova tabella nello strumento di output crea una tabella gestita in Hive.